Molecular Biology Schools in Ohio

47 students earned Molecular Biology degrees in Ohio in the 2022-2023 year.

As a degree choice, Molecular Biology is the 520th most popular major in the state.

Racial Distribution

The racial distribution of molecular biology majors in Ohio is as follows:

  • Asian: 2.1%
  • Black or African American: 6.4%
  • Hispanic or Latino: 2.1%
  • White: 66.0%
  • Non-Resident Alien: 17.0%
  • Other Races: 6.4%

Jobs for Molecular Biology Grads in Ohio

7,060 people in the state and 274,990 in the nation are employed in jobs related to molecular biology.

undefined

Wages for Molecular Biology Jobs in Ohio

In this state, molecular biology grads earn an average of $79,020. Nationwide, they make an average of $96,420.
